Occupational Health and Safety (OHS) is a systematic and interdisciplinary activity to identify, analyze and reduce the potential safety and health hazards of workers caused by the activities in workplace. When dealing with an OHS risk analysis problem, how to assess the risk of occupational hazards is a crucial step and a big challenge. In this paper, we aim to develop a new OHS risk assessment model by integrating Picture Fuzzy Sets (PFSs) and Alternative Queuing Method (AQM) to assess and rank the risk of occupational hazards for corrective actions. To this end, the PFSs are utilized to address the vague and uncertain assessment information provided by experts and an improved AQM is introduced to acquire the risk priority of the recognized occupational hazards. Furthermore, we extend the Best Worst Method (BWM) to derive the relative weights of risk criteria based on picture fuzzy information. Finally, a practical example of excavation in a construction yard is provided to illustrate the feasibility and superiority of our proposed OHS risk assessment model. The results indicate that the new risk assessment method is able to produce more reliable risk ranking results of occupational hazards, and provides a practical and effective way for risk analysis in OHS.
